What to Look for When Comparing Self Storage Near Eastbourne

A genuinely all-in price

Headline monthly rates can be deceptive. Some facilities advertise a low starting price, then add compulsory insurance, access fees, or a refundable deposit on top. Before committing, ask for the exact total monthly cost with everything included — no surprises on the first invoice. If a provider is vague on this, that's usually a warning sign.

Access hours that suit your schedule

Many self storage buildings operate during standard business hours — often 8am to 6pm on weekdays, with reduced or no access at weekends. If you work irregular hours, run a business, or might need to collect something at short notice, restricted access becomes a real inconvenience quickly. Look for facilities that offer 24-hour access, every day of the year, with no pre-booking required.

Practical access to your unit

There's a significant practical difference between driving up to a container door and loading directly from your vehicle, and parking in a car park then carrying items through a building, along corridors, and into a lift. If you're moving furniture, storing business stock, or loading and unloading anything bulky, drive-up access saves a considerable amount of time and effort.

Security

At a minimum, look for CCTV covering the storage areas, secure perimeter fencing or access control, and individual locks on units. A site visit before you commit is always worthwhile — it quickly becomes clear how well-maintained and secure a facility actually is.

Flexible month-to-month terms

Many storage providers tie customers in with minimum contracts of three or six months. If you're storing during a house move, a renovation, or a short-term business project, you could easily end up paying for months of storage you don't need. Always ask about the minimum term and notice period before signing.

Why Container Storage Often Beats Traditional Self Storage for Value

Self storage units at traditional facilities come in standard sizes and can be expensive per square foot — particularly with national chains, where the real cost often becomes clear only once fees are added up.

A 20ft shipping container, by contrast, gives you approximately 1,170 cubic feet of storage — roughly the equivalent of a single garage. For most people storing furniture, business stock, tools, or the contents of a property during a move, this is an enormous amount of usable space at a fraction of what a traditional facility would charge for the same volume.
